POEA imposes total ban on OFW deployment in Iraq except for one region
MANILA, June 16 (PNA) — The Philippine Overseas Employment Administration (POEA) has issued a resolution imposing a total deployment ban on the processing and deployment of all Overseas Filipino Workers (OFWs) bound for Iraq except for the Iraqi Kurdistan Region which “remains calm and stable” as per the Department of Foreign Affairs (DFA) advisory. POEA encourages OFWs to take polio vaccines
The Philippine Overseas Employment Administration encourages overseas Filipino workers to take polio vaccines due to an outbreak in ten countries according to the World Health Organization. The POEA further added that recruitment agencies and foreign employers should shoulder the cost of the vaccination.
POEA Lifts Deployment Ban to Yemen
The Philippine Overseas Employment Administration lifted the deployment ban for returning OFWs to Yemen two months after it was implemented. The lifting of the ban came about after the improvement in the political environment of said country. But Labor and Employment Secretary and POEA Chairman Rosalinda Baldos said that the deployment ban remains for newly-hired OFWs in Yemen
